With the growth of digital photography, many photographers, both

amateur and professional approach their work in a new way. We see

them as often in front of computers as behind viewfinders, using

digital imaging software, scanners and photo quality ink jet printers.

Words and phrases come out of their mouths like "DPI," "image size"

and "lightfastness". Kathy will present a non-technical overview of

photo output by focusing on the lineup of Epson printers and their

application. The audience will learn more about how the printers

work to create photo quality prints. The mystery will be taken out of

topics like pigment vs. dye-based inks, the longevity and durability of

the print, and paper options. Attendees will walk away with more of

an understanding why professional photographers choose Epson

printers four to one over any other brand.
